Measuring curve of spee using digital methods and defining its relationship to different angle classes

International Journal of Applied Dental Sciences · 2023 · Vol. 9(3) · pp. 245–248
Radiyah Majed Al-Qallaf

Abstract

Aim of the study: This cross-sectional study is aiming for investigating the relationships of the depth of curve of Spee with different Angle classes.Materials and Methods: A sample of 240 study models were collected and scanned digitally to measure the depth of curve of Spee. The sample has been divided into 4 groups including: Angle Class I, Angle Class II Division 1, Angle Class II Division 2 and Angle Class III with 60 study models in each group.
